
Oliva Nova, Spain – February 18, 2021 – The seesaw battle Harold Boisset (FRA) made his presence known once again at the Mediterranean Equestrian Tour, claiming top honors aboard T’Obetty du Domaine in the €25,800 Speed Challenge CSI 3*, one of the qualifiers for the Grand Prix during the second week of Spring MET II.
The Frenchman and the 2007 chestnut Selle Français mare (Kashmir Van Schuttershof x Diams du Grasset) triumphed in the 1.45m contest, blazing across the finish line after a penalty-free effort in 66.63 seconds.
Dayro Arroyave (COL) had another solid performance, guiding Baccarat Fontaine (Mylord Carthago*HN x Quartz du Vallon) towards silver honors backed by a clean effort in 67.79 seconds.
Another successful rider and former winner at the venue, Andres Vereecke (BEL) secured bronze honors. The Belgian rode Diadarco van Evendael Z (Diamant de Semilly x Darco) flawlessly, stopping the timers in 69.02 seconds.
Final Results – €25,800 Speed Challenge CSI 3*
1) Harold Boisset (FRA) & T’Obetty du Domaine – 0 – 66.63
2) Dayro Arroyave (COL) & Baccarat Fontaine – 0 – 67.79
3) Andres Vereecke (BEL) & Diadarco van Evendael Z – 0 – 69.02
